#4f23e4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4f23e4 is composed of 31% red, 13.7% green and 89.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.4% cyan, 84.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 253.7 degrees, a saturation of 78.1% and a lightness of 51.6%. #4f23e4 color hex could be obtained by blending #9e46ff with #0000c9.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

#4f23e4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4f23e4 has RGB values of R:79, G:35, B:228 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0.85,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 5186532.
